// Package instance provides instances management.
package instance
import (
"github.com/gogf/gf/v2/container/gmap"
"github.com/gogf/gf/v2/encoding/ghash"
)
const (
groupNumber = 64
)
var (
groups = make([]*gmap.StrAnyMap, groupNumber)
)
func init() {
for i := 0; i < groupNumber; i++ {
groups[i] = gmap.NewStrAnyMap(true)
}
}
func getGroup(key string) *gmap.StrAnyMap {
return groups[int(ghash.DJB([]byte(key))%groupNumber)]
}
// Get returns the instance by given name.
func Get(name string) interface{} {
return getGroup(name).Get(name)
}
// Set sets an instance to the instance manager with given name.
func Set(name string, instance interface{}) {
getGroup(name).Set(name, instance)
}
// GetOrSet returns the instance by name,
// or set instance to the instance manager if it does not exist and returns this instance.
func GetOrSet(name string, instance interface{}) interface{} {
return getGroup(name).GetOrSet(name, instance)
}
// GetOrSetFunc returns the instance by name,
// or sets instance with returned value of callback function `f` if it does not exist
// and then returns this instance.
func GetOrSetFunc(name string, f func() interface{}) interface{} {
return getGroup(name).GetOrSetFunc(name, f)
}
// GetOrSetFuncLock returns the instance by name,
// or sets instance with returned value of callback function `f` if it does not exist
// and then returns this instance.
//
// GetOrSetFuncLock differs with GetOrSetFunc function is that it executes function `f`
// with mutex.Lock of the hash map.
func GetOrSetFuncLock(name string, f func() interface{}) interface{} {
return getGroup(name).GetOrSetFuncLock(name, f)
}
// SetIfNotExist sets `instance` to the map if the `name` does not exist, then returns true.
// It returns false if `name` exists, and `instance` would be ignored.
func SetIfNotExist(name string, instance interface{}) bool {
return getGroup(name).SetIfNotExist(name, instance)
}
// Clear deletes all instances stored.
func Clear() {
for i := 0; i < groupNumber; i++ {
groups[i].Clear()
}
}

package instance_test
import (
"testing"
"github.com/gogf/gf/v2/internal/instance"
"github.com/gogf/gf/v2/test/gtest"
)
func Test_SetGet(t *testing.T) {
gtest.C(t, func(t *gtest.T) {
instance.Set("test-user", 1)
t.Assert(instance.Get("test-user"), 1)
t.Assert(instance.Get("none-exists"), nil)
})
gtest.C(t, func(t *gtest.T) {
t.Assert(instance.GetOrSet("test-1", 1), 1)
t.Assert(instance.Get("test-1"), 1)
})
gtest.C(t, func(t *gtest.T) {
t.Assert(instance.GetOrSetFunc("test-2", func() interface{} {
return 2
}), 2)
t.Assert(instance.Get("test-2"), 2)
})
gtest.C(t, func(t *gtest.T) {
t.Assert(instance.GetOrSetFuncLock("test-3", func() interface{} {
return 3
}), 3)
t.Assert(instance.Get("test-3"), 3)
})
gtest.C(t, func(t *gtest.T) {
t.Assert(instance.SetIfNotExist("test-4", 4), true)
t.Assert(instance.Get("test-4"), 4)
t.Assert(instance.SetIfNotExist("test-4", 5), false)
t.Assert(instance.Get("test-4"), 4)
})
}
